O ye tree sans shade,
Under thee no one rested,
Thine fruits no'ne tasted.
O path of love so lonely,
No one looked at thee,
Lost love seems thine fate.
O island of peace,
No one sought thy bliss,
And no one seems it to miss.
O birds of heaven,
Thou art the sole one
That come, nestle and return.
